Hidaka is a nice place to visit during the autumn. You can see a very unique flower called Higanbana in Japanese, or red spider lily, at Kinchakuda Manjyushage Park, at Hidaka city in Saitama. September is the best season for higanbana. Japanese people say when this flower blooms, autumn has begun. Usually this flower is red, but sometimes white, pink and yellow too. Hidaka is in the southern part of Saitama Prefecture and you can go by car or by train. Just take the Seibu-Ikebukuro Line and alight at Koma Station.
